WHAT IS THE DG OIL SPECIFICATIONS AND WHAT IS THE
DIFFERENCE BETWEEN THE DG OIL AND TRANSFORMER OIL
Answer Posted / sanjay
DG lube oil Specification is 15W/40,also it acts lubricants,
Transormer oil Specification is as per IS 335 and it is
mineral oil insulating and cooling&minimise the size of
transformer
